Pairing Macartee with Clean Sans Serif Fonts for Body Copy
One of the first questions I ask when testing a new typeface is, "What will I pair it with?" Macartee, being a bold display font, naturally pairs well with clean, neutral sans serif fonts. For a recent coaching website project, I used Macartee for the main section headings and a lightweight sans serif for the body text. This created a clear visual hierarchy. The headings grabbed attention, while the body copy remained highly readable. This pairing is a safe bet for maintaining professionalism and ensuring that your content is easy to scan. When you combine a strong vintage typeface with a simple modern font, you create a dynamic contrast that feels both grounded and fresh.
Testing Macartee on Mobile Screens and Responsive Layouts
Readability on smaller screens is a non-negotiable part of modern web design. When I tested Macartee on mobile, I found it performed exceptionally well in headlines and call-to-action buttons where the text was kept concise. Because it's a display font, it's best reserved for large text sizes. For example, using it for a primary headline on a product landing page works perfectly. I scaled the hero text down to around 32px on an iPhone 14 screen, and the smooth curves and sleek lines remained clear. Just be sure to check your font sizes in responsive mode. The bold weight of this typeface ensures it remains legible even when placed over busy image backgrounds, which is a common challenge in responsive layouts.
